Suppose at the beginning of 2014, Jamaal's basis in his S corporation stock is $1,000, and he has a $10,000 debt basis associated with a $10,000 loan he made to the S corporation. In 2014, Jamaal's share of S corporation income is $4,000, and he received a $7,000 distribution from the S corporation. How much income does Jamaal report in 2014 from these transactions?
